Toyota MR2 Mk3

FOR: Fastest and most engaging, simplicity AGAINST: Very impractica­l, most expensive

TOYOTA’S third-generation ‘Midship Runabout 2’ was reminiscen­t of the original, with a back-tobasics approach. The looks won’t be to all tastes and there’s limited luggage space, but the MR2’S mid-engined, rear-wheel-drive layout, low weight and soft-top roof make it a riot to drive.

Its revvy 1.8-litre engine gave it strong performanc­e and decent economy, too. A 2003 example with 80,000 miles can be yours for £1,895.

ITS interior is pretty stripped back, but the MR2 is well screwed together. The biggest issue is a lack of storage space – there’s no real boot, only a briefcase-sized stowage area above the spare wheel in the front.

TOYOTA’S reputation for reliabilit­y is well earned. Early MR2S suffered a potentiall­y serious engine issue, but a post-2001 model with a good service history should be dependable. Just watch out for subframe rust.
